Manchester United identify potential replacement for David de Gea

25 August 2019 - 11:25

Manchester United are reportedly monitoring the proceedings of Dinamo Zagreb goalkeeper Dominik Livakovic ahead of a potential move for his services next year.

  • The Red Devils have been expecting to extend David de Gea's contract for the past few weeks but so far, there has been no indication that the Spaniard will put pen-to-paper on a fresh deal.

    As a result, there are concerns that he could leave United on a free transfer when his contract expires next summer and the club are presently looking at possible options, who could replace the Spaniard.

    According to The Sun, Ole Gunnar Solskjaer's side are currently keeping a close eye on Livakovic, who has previously been on the radar of Tottenham Hotspur and Liverpool.

    The 24-year-old, who has already usurped Monaco's Daniel Subasic to the Croatian number one role, would be available for a fee in the region of £15m to 20m when the season concludes.
